Toyota Motors is reported to be doing an ethanol production feasibility report in Brazil and has teamed up with the local energy company Petrobras for assistance. If things go along to their logical conclusion, then the pairing will develop an ethanol production plant.
In the Brazil auto market alone, flex fuel vehicles control four-fifths of the industry.
